The location, part of the Mokattam Hill near the center of Cairo, was once famous for its fresh breeze and grand views of the city, and was fortified by Saladin between 1176 and 1183 AD, to protect it from the Crusaders . The Citadel stopped being the seat of government when Egypt's ruler, Khedive Ismail, moved to his newly built Abdin Palace in the Ismailiya neighborhood in the 1860s.
